The town announced earlier this year that it would be trying something new in the centennial planter at the end of our main street. For years, it’s featured a beautiful display of flowers that project the image of a buffalo. It was a hit with tourists, who we’d often spot being photographed in front of it. When done right, we loved it, too.
In recent years, though, it’s only been good for about a month or two. As the town has added properties and buildings for the public works crew to maintain, the planter didn’t get the attention it needed. By mid to late summer, the weeds had taken over.
We wholeheartedly agree: It’s time to try something new.
